AR20064 Professional placement 1

Credits: 12
Level: Intermediate
Semester: 2
Assessment: CW 100%
Requisites:
Before taking this unit you must take AR20018 and After taking this module you must take AR30019
Aims: The thin sandwich system at Bath offers students the opportunity to experience a range of employment in architectural practices, or in other activities that are related to the academic and professional nature of the course. Aims and objectives are stipulated as part of an RIBA Professional Experience and Development Record (PEDR) to be completed by the student and his/her employer.
Learning Outcomes:
Ability to integrate design and professional skills in the workplace.
Skills:
Integration of design and professional skills with the workplace. Group working with other trades and professions.
Content:
The Department will support all students in their search for placements, and will offer guidance in the preparation of applications. However, employment is not guaranteed, and all students who are unsuccessful in finding employment will be required to pursue activities that will form a useful contribution to their development. The students will prepare an A1 panel which illustrates an aspect of their placement experience.
